Whether you need simple “How to….?” advice or confidential counselling, fact sheets or self-directed resources and lifestyle services, your Employee Assistance Program (EAP) is here to help you take steps to achieve optimal health and well-being.

The University of Saskatchewan’s Employee Assistance Program has been designed to:

  • provide immediate assistance in times of crisis
  • support you through life stage transitions (e.g. marriage, birth, career change, blended family challenges, bereavement, or planning retirement)
  • help you tackle everyday issues of life to prevent problems from becoming overwhelming
  • provide support and advice for achieving your health goals, and help you attain new heights of well-being
  • help you deal with depression, anxiety, fear, substance abuse, or existing personal health issues

The EAP provides you with access to confidential counselling services at no cost to you.
